2012-06-21 3 views
3

На данный момент я затухаю компоненты в/из в размере 0.1 alpha/second. Я читал несколько примеров в Интернете, которые используют 0.03 alpha/second. Существует ли стандартная ставка, при которой компоненты должны исчезать/выходить? Существует ли стандартная скорость анимации перехода?Java Swing: существует ли стандартная скорость затухания?

+1

Существует связанный пример [здесь] (http://stackoverflow.com/a/2234020/230513). Вы ищете обоснование, основанное на человеческих факторах? – trashgod

ответ

4

Я не верю, что такой стандарт существует и будет когда-либо существовать для этого причин:

  • Это в основном субъективны
  • Это зависит от скорости приложения. Если ваше приложение работает медленно, вы скорее сделаете медленный эффект, чтобы соответствовать остальному или замаскировать медлительность.
  • Это зависит от того, что находится внутри ваших компонентов. Например, имеет смысл, что уведомление о рычаге будет медленно исчезать, когда окно предупреждения будет быстро исчезать, как только вы нажмете «ok»
  • Увядание - это просто эффект, который не будет влиять на пользователя, если он не влияют на функциональный опыт (например, затухание затухания, которое позволяет избежать использования другой функции, когда это происходит).

 Смежные вопросы

  • Нет связанных вопросов^_^